About the role
As a Patrol Unarmed Officer at a retail location, you will conduct routine vehicle and foot patrols, maintain a visible presence to help deter security-related incidents, and provide outstanding customer service. This driving position requires a valid driver’s license in accordance with Allied Universal driver policy requirements. Responsibilities
- Provide customer service to clients, customers, and visitors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and, when appropriate, emergency response activities.
- Respond to incidents, customer concerns, and critical situations in a calm, professional, problem-solving manner.
- Conduct regular and random unarmed patrols throughout the retail location, including sales areas, entrances, parking areas, loading areas, and the perimeter.
- Monitor for unusual activity, policy violations, and potential hazards, and report observations to site leadership and/or appropriate personnel.
- Assist with access control, traffic flow, and incident documentation while maintaining a professional presence that helps to deter unwanted activity.
